RESCUE HORSE FEED REGIMEN

ALOHA,
I HAVE HAD THE WONDERFULL OPPORTUNITY TO TAKE IN 2 RESCUE HORSES. THEY WERE LEFT IN A "ROCK" PASTURE FOR ABOUT SIX MONTHS WITH MINIMAL TO NO FEED, AND AWFUL WATER. WE GOT THEM UP TO THE HOUSE, AND THEY ARE ON A FAIRLY PROTEIN ENHANCED DIET, WITH RICE MEAL... AND OF COURSE A FEW TREATS EVERY DAY. THE HAIR ON THE TAIL AND MAIN IS FINALLY COMMING BACK, AND THEY HAVE BOTH PUT ON ABOUT 75 POUNDS... BUT I AM CURIOUS TO SEE IF THERE IS ANYWAY I CAN ENHANCE THEIR DIET TO MAKE SURE THAT GET ALL THE SUPPLEMENTS THEY NEED INTERNALLY AND EXTERNALLY. IF ANY ONE HAS ANY SUGGESSTIONS I WOULS LOVE TO HEAR THEM.

THEY ARE ALSO ON 10 ACRES OF GREEN GRASS, SO THEY CAN BUILD UP THIER MUSCLES, AGAIN, I HAVE NOT BEEN AROUND HORSES IN ABOUT 16 YEARS SO I AM LEARNING ALL OVER AGAIN... BUT LOVING IT.

Re: RESCUE HORSE FEED REGIMEN

Hello Jennifer,

Let me first commend you for taking in these horses. They are very lucky to have found you!

You're wise to consider a vitamin supplement. This will fill in the gaps that are in the diet. I would recommend one that has a flaxseed meal base because this would provide Omega 3 fatty acids for healthy skin and haircoat, as well as healthy feet, joints, and overall immune protection. My best recommendation is Glanzen Complete.
